'The reality is, finding a guy is maybe not your best economic choice in the long term,' says the author who also defends Cattrall's decision not to return for 'And Just Like That... .'

) main love interest in the series — of their own should not be one’s primary goal in life.

“The reality is, finding a guy is maybe not your best economic choice in the long term. Men can be very dangerous to women in a lot of different ways. We never talk about this, but that’s something that women need to think about: You can do a lot less . . . when you have to rely on a man,” Bushnell said. “The TV show and the message were not very feminist at the end. But that’s TV. That’s entertainment. That’s why people should not base their lives on a TV show.
